Maneli Jamal:
East through to west acoustic guitar.
Maneli Jamal is a solo acoustic guitarist, offering a new perspective on
approaching the acoustic guitar with influences from both the east and west
combined. Having dedicated himself to the exploration of acoustic guitar
technique, Maneli has developed his own sound. Folk, Flamenco, and Persian modes
combine with his own percussive technique creating a rich and unique voice on
the guitar.
Persian by blood and raised in Germany, Maneli moved to the States in his
adolescence, immigrating to Minnesota before relocating to Austin, Texas until
his late teens. At this time, his family was issued a letter of deportation by
the immigration office, and were forced to claim refuge in Canada within thirty
days of receiving the notice. Taking literally only what they could fit in their
hands, Maneli arrived in Toronto with his guitar which has scarcely left his
hands since.
Having lived in 4 different countries and moved 20 times by the time he was 18,
Maneli has let his experiences around the world influence the way he speaks with
the guitar.
Maneli received first place in the online YouTube acoustic guitar competition
for Taylor guitars and Faith Guitars, placed in the finals for Guitar Idol 2009,
has released his debut album featuring 14 tracks of all original compositions,
and is endorsed by Cole Clark guitars.
